Signs Your Heating System Needs Immediate Attention
Uneven Heating or Cold Spots
You find certain areas of your Rancho Santa Fe home are consistently colder than others, despite the thermostat being set appropriately. In larger, custom-built properties, this is particularly noticeable in distant wings, guest suites, or upstairs rooms. This often indicates issues with airflow, ductwork integrity, or a multi-zone system struggling to distribute heat efficiently.
When a heating system is out of balance, it fails to push conditioned air evenly to the furthest reaches of your property. Ignoring this means ongoing discomfort and wasted energy as the system overcompensates to heat areas it cannot effectively reach. A proper tune-up identifies the exact airflow restrictions causing these frustrating cold spots.
Unexpectedly High Utility Bills
Your monthly energy statements show a noticeable increase, even if your heating usage has not drastically changed. A sudden spike in bills is a primary sign of an inefficient heating system. This is often caused by dirty filters, a failing motor, or uncalibrated components that force the unit to work much harder than necessary.
When your system struggles against internal friction or restricted airflow, it draws significantly more electricity or gas to produce the same amount of heat. Without a proper tune-up, this inefficiency will continue to drain your wallet month after month. It could also point to larger, more costly mechanical problems developing quietly in the background.
Unusual Noises or Odors
You hear strange sounds like banging, squealing, rattling, or grinding coming from your furnace or vents. You might also notice a persistent musty, burning, or electrical smell that was not there before. In a serene, quiet environment, these mechanical disruptions are impossible to ignore and signal immediate trouble.
These noises and smells are strong indicators of mechanical issues like a loose blower belt, a failing inducer motor, a dirty burner, or electrical shorts. A squealing sound often means a bearing is failing, while a sudden bang can indicate delayed gas ignition. Addressing these warning signs promptly prevents complete system breakdowns and potential safety hazards.
Frequent Cycling
Your heating system turns on and off frequently, running for short bursts instead of longer, consistent cycles. It seems to struggle to maintain a steady temperature, leaving your home feeling drafty and uncomfortable. This short cycling can be caused by a clogged filter, an oversized system, or a faulty thermostat misreading the room temperature.
Constant starting and stopping wears out mechanical parts much faster and reduces the overall lifespan of your equipment. It also consumes significantly more energy than a system running on normal, sustained cycles. Our maintenance process identifies the root cause of this erratic behavior and restores smooth operation.
Weak or Lukewarm Airflow
When the heating system is on, the air coming from your vents feels weak or not as warm as it should be. It fails to adequately heat the large volumes of air in spacious rooms, leaving you reaching for extra blankets. This symptom often points to restricted airflow due to dirty filters, blocked vents, or a blower motor that is losing power.
Reduced airflow diminishes your comfort and forces your furnace heat exchanger to retain too much heat. This increases energy consumption and can eventually lead to overheating, which trips safety switches and shuts the system down entirely. Restoring proper airflow is a critical component of any comprehensive maintenance visit.
What Is Actually Causing Your Heating Issues
Neglected Filters and Airflow Restrictions
Over time, your system air filters become clogged with dust, pet dander, and other airborne particles. This buildup severely restricts the flow of warm air throughout your home, choking the system. The arid climate and extensive landscaping common in Rancho Santa Fe lead to a higher accumulation of fine dust and pollen.
These environmental factors rapidly clog filters, significantly impacting both airflow and indoor air quality. When the blower motor has to pull air through a wall of dirt, it draws more amperage and runs hotter, which can lead to premature motor failure. Our maintenance process includes inspecting and replacing dirty filters to ensure proper airflow and optimize system efficiency.
Uncalibrated Thermostats and Sensors
A thermostat that is not accurately calibrated will misread your home temperature, causing your furnace to cycle inefficiently. In multi-zone homes, individual zone sensors can drift out of calibration over time due to dust or minor electrical faults. This leads to specific areas being too hot or cold, even if the main central thermostat seems correct.
When communication between the thermostat and the furnace control board breaks down, your system simply cannot maintain a comfortable environment. We meticulously check and calibrate your thermostat and system sensors during our visit. This ensures precise temperature control and optimal operation across every zone in your property.
Wear and Tear on Moving Parts
Components like blower motors, belts, and bearings naturally experience friction and wear down over time. While your heating system might not run continuously for months, the intermittent cycling during cooler periods still stresses these components. This is especially true in older or larger systems where the mechanical load required to push air through extensive ductwork is much higher.
Without proper lubrication, metal-on-metal friction increases the operating temperature of these parts, leading to eventual failure. During a tune-up, we inspect, clean, lubricate, and adjust these moving parts to reduce stress. This proactive care prevents unexpected breakdowns and extends the overall lifespan of your heating system.
Dirty Burners and Ignition Issues
Soot and carbon deposits can accumulate on your furnace burners, preventing them from igniting properly or burning fuel efficiently. This leads to incomplete combustion, which is a critical issue for both heating efficiency and household safety. Ensuring clean combustion is essential for the sophisticated heating systems found in high-end homes where consistent performance is expected.
If the flame sensor becomes coated in carbon, it may fail to register that the burners have lit, causing the system to shut down as a safety precaution. Our technicians thoroughly clean the burners and check the entire ignition sequence to ensure safe, complete combustion. This maximizes your heat output while minimizing unnecessary fuel waste and safety risks.

Precision Cleaning and Lubrication
Once the inspection is complete, we move on to thoroughly cleaning critical components like burners, flame sensors, and the blower assembly. Removing the dust, dirt, and debris that hinder performance is essential for restoring your system to peak efficiency. We also replace dirty air filters and clear any blockages around the intake areas.
After cleaning, we carefully lubricate all moving parts, including motor bearings and blower belts, to reduce internal friction. We check and tighten all electrical connections to prevent voltage drops that can damage sensitive control boards. This detailed attention to the mechanical and electrical health of your system prevents premature wear and tear.
Safety Controls and Calibration
Finally, we test your system safety controls, including high-limit switches and carbon monoxide detectors, to guarantee safe operation. We measure airflow across the heat exchanger to ensure it falls within the manufacturer specifications. We also verify proper thermostat calibration to ensure accurate temperature regulation throughout your home.

Safety and System Longevity
Beyond the financial implications, an inefficient or faulty heating system can compromise your indoor air quality and pose serious safety risks. If combustion issues are present due to dirty burners or a cracked heat exchanger, your system could leak dangerous carbon monoxide into your living spaces. Regular maintenance includes strict safety checks to ensure all exhaust gases are venting properly and safely outside.
Proactive maintenance ensures not just comfort, but also the safety and longevity of your home essential heating system. By keeping the internal components clean and well-calibrated, you can add years to the operational life of your equipment.
